National Pipeline Safety & Operations Research Center
Description
The academic programs at Texas A&M University and New Mexico State University provide expertise in all areas related to pipeline technology, such as civil, industrial, mechanical, chemical, and petroleum engineering. The National Pipeline Safety & Operations Research Center coordinates the joint participation of these disciplines on research activities that promote the safe and efficient transportation of petroleum and chemical commodities through the United States' extensive pipeline network.
Mission
The National Pipeline Safety & Operations Research Center is a consortium between New Mexico State University and the Texas A&M University System's Texas Transportation Institute. This alignment has been established to promote the safe construction, operation, and inspection of natural gas and liquid pipelines through the advancement of pipeline technology, policy, and education.

Research Initiatives
Current or planned research by the National Pipeline Safety & Operations Research Center includes:
- NDE applications to monitor structural integrity,
- Use of remote sensors and low cost electronics to communicate pipeline conditions,
- Review of codes and specifications for static testing,
- Sensor system applications for leak detection,
- Leak detection using fluid transport technology,
- Integrity and monitoring of coastline and offshore pipelines,
- Prediction and prevention of third party damage,
- Impact of pipeline policies on the expansion of transportation infrastructures,
- Compliance of port and waterway policies with pipeline construction and operation, and
- Incorporation of demographic data into risk analyses/GIS applications.
